What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a fuel truck driver in the USA?

To thrive as a Fuel Truck Driver in the USA, you need a valid Commercial Driver’s License (CDL) with hazardous materials (HazMat) and tanker endorsements, along with a strong understanding of safety regulations and fuel handling procedures. Familiarity with electronic logging devices (ELDs), GPS navigation systems, and fuel delivery equipment is typically required. Attention to detail, strong communication skills, and reliability are essential soft skills for ensuring safe and efficient deliveries. These competencies are crucial for maintaining regulatory compliance, minimizing safety risks, and providing dependable fuel transport services.

What are common challenges faced by fuel truck drivers in the USA, and how can they prepare for them?

Fuel truck drivers in the USA often face challenges such as managing long hours on the road, adhering to strict safety regulations, and handling hazardous materials. Adverse weather conditions and navigating high-traffic areas can also add complexity to their daily routes. To prepare, drivers should prioritize completing all required safety training, maintain up-to-date certifications (such as a CDL with HAZMAT endorsement), and develop strong time-management and stress-management skills. Engaging in regular communication with dispatchers and staying informed about route updates can also help manage these challenges effectively.

What are fuel jobs in the USA?

Fuel jobs in the USA refer to positions involved in the production, distribution, transportation, and management of fuel sources such as gasoline, diesel, natural gas, and renewable energy. These jobs can range from fuel truck drivers and refinery operators to fuel distribution managers and environmental compliance specialists. Workers in this field ensure the safe and efficient delivery of fuel to consumers, businesses, and industries across the country. The sector is vital for powering vehicles, homes, and businesses, and it also includes roles focused on sustainability and reducing environmental impact.
